On Mon, Dec 13, 2010 at 12:52:41PM +0100, suvayu ali wrote:
> I just tested this, it seems to work as expected.
>
>
> * Smearing :smear:
> :PROPERTIES:
> :EXPORT_FILE_NAME: tmp/smearing.html
> :END:
>
> ** Some sub-tree 1
>
> ** Some sub-tree 2
>
>
> Does this not work for you?
it works if i export a subtree (C-c C-e 1 l), but not if i export a region (set
mark, highlight region, then C-c C-e l). also, it doesn't expand a tilde ~ to my
home directory, so writing
:EXPORT_FILE_NAME: ~/tmp/temp.tex
doesn't do what one would expect. (note that i can't write the full path because
i switch between linux and OS X, which expand ~ differently: linux to
/home/<name>,
OS X to /Users/<name>.)
also, i'd like to be able to specify an export directory for the entire org
file, not just a subtree.
